FujiFilm AV200 vs Pentax RS1500 Key Specs

FujiFilm AV200
(Full Review)
  • 14MP - 1/2.3" Sensor
  • 2.7" Fixed Screen
  • ISO 100 - 1600 (Expand to 3200)
  • 1280 x 720 video
  • 32-96mm (F2.9-5.2) lens
  • 168g - 93 x 60 x 28mm
  • Released January 2011
  • Alternate Name is FinePix AV205
Pentax RS1500
(Full Review)
  • 14MP - 1/2.3" Sensor
  • 2.7" Fixed Display
  • ISO 80 - 6400
  • 1280 x 720 video
  • 28-110mm (F3.5-5.5) lens
  • 157g - 114 x 58 x 28mm
  • Introduced March 2011

FujiFilm AV200 vs Pentax RS1500 Physical Comparison

For anybody who is planning to travel with your camera regularly, you will have to consider its weight and dimensions. The FujiFilm AV200 features external dimensions of 93mm x 60mm x 28mm (3.7" x 2.4" x 1.1") with a weight of 168 grams (0.37 lbs) while the Pentax RS1500 has dimensions of 114mm x 58mm x 28mm (4.5" x 2.3" x 1.1") with a weight of 157 grams (0.35 lbs).

FujiFilm AV200 vs Pentax RS1500 Sensor Comparison

Oftentimes, it is very hard to picture the difference between sensor dimensions just by checking technical specs. The image below may offer you a much better sense of the sensor dimensions in the AV200 and RS1500.

As you have seen, each of the cameras provide the same sensor dimensions and the exact same megapixels so you can expect similar quality of photos but you should take the age of the products into consideration.
